ISP Network Management
Svoboda, Filip ; Pavláček, Martin (referee) ; Ondrák, Viktor (advisor)
The subject of this thesis is management of computer network managed by internet service provider in the village Boleradice. Based on the analysis of current management practices weakness in monitoring was revealed. In order to address this issue a server was purchased, on which was installed Nagios, an advanced monitoring tool. The benefit of this project is increased efficiency and improved management of the network and ability to quickly respond to outages of network devices.

Micromouse II mobile Robot
Pavláček, Martin ; Věchet, Stanislav (referee) ; Marada, Tomáš (advisor)
This thesis describes the design and implementation of mobile robot IEEE Micromouse category. The aim is to build a functional design of robot usable to testing methods of mapping and localization. The thesis also deals with the design of electronics for motion control. Electronic design of optical sensors operating on the principle of reflection of infrared light and the signal processing.
